in

Rich and Creamy Homemade Alfredo Sauce

WANT TO SAVE THIS RECIPE?

Few sauces feel as instantly comforting as a warm pan of homemade Alfredo sauce. It turns simple pasta into a restaurant-style dinner with barely any effort, coating every strand in a silky, buttery blanket of cream and Parmesan. When it is made from scratch, the flavor is deeper, fresher, and far more luxurious than anything from a jar.

Pin this Recipe

This Rich and Creamy Homemade Alfredo Sauce is the kind of kitchen staple that earns a permanent spot in your dinner rotation. It comes together quickly, tastes indulgent without being complicated, and works beautifully for everything from fettuccine night to baked pasta, chicken dishes, and vegetable-forward meals.

Why You’ll Love This Rich and Creamy Homemade Alfredo Sauce

This sauce delivers the kind of smooth, velvety texture people expect from their favorite Italian-American comfort food, but with a homemade flavor that tastes cleaner and richer. The butter adds depth, the cream creates body, and the Parmesan melts into the sauce for that signature savory finish.

It is also wonderfully versatile. You can spoon it over fettuccine, toss it with shrimp, drizzle it over roasted vegetables, or use it as the creamy base for casseroles and skillet dinners. Once you know how to make it, you will find yourself reaching for this recipe whenever dinner needs a little extra comfort.

What Makes Homemade Alfredo Sauce So Rich and Smooth?

The secret is balance. A truly rich Alfredo sauce depends on a few simple ingredients that each play an important role. Butter gives the sauce its luxurious foundation, heavy cream creates the silky body, and freshly grated Parmesan brings flavor while helping the sauce thicken naturally. Gentle heat matters too. Keeping the sauce warm rather than aggressively boiling it helps everything melt together into a smooth, glossy finish instead of turning grainy or greasy.

Ingredients

Before you start cooking, gather everything you need and keep it close to the stove. Alfredo sauce moves quickly once the butter melts, so having the ingredients ready makes the process much easier and helps the texture stay silky from the very beginning.

  • Butter – creates the rich base and gives the sauce its signature luxurious mouthfeel.
  • Heavy cream – provides the thick, velvety texture that makes Alfredo sauce so luscious.
  • Garlic – adds gentle savory depth and keeps the sauce from tasting flat.
  • Freshly grated Parmesan cheese – melts into the sauce for salty, nutty flavor and natural thickening.
  • Salt – sharpens the flavor and balances the dairy richness.
  • Black pepper – adds mild warmth and a little bite.
  • Italian seasoning or fresh parsley – brings a fresh herbal note that brightens the sauce.
  • Pasta water – helps loosen the sauce when needed and makes it cling beautifully to noodles.

How To Make the Rich and Creamy Homemade Alfredo Sauce

Making Rich and Creamy Homemade Alfredo Sauce is quick, but a gentle pace gives you the best results. This is the kind of sauce that rewards patience and low heat, so let each step work before moving on.

Step 1: Melt the Butter Base

Place a skillet or saucepan over medium-low heat and melt the butter until it is fully liquid and just beginning to foam. Add the garlic and stir for a short moment until fragrant. You want the garlic softened, not browned, so the flavor stays sweet and mellow.

Step 2: Pour in the Cream

Slowly add the heavy cream and stir to combine it with the butter. Let the mixture warm gently for a few minutes so the flavors begin to blend. The cream should look smooth and slightly steamy, but it should not come to a rapid boil.

Step 3: Add the Parmesan

Reduce the heat to low and sprinkle in the freshly grated Parmesan a little at a time, whisking or stirring constantly. This gradual addition helps the cheese melt evenly into the cream instead of clumping. As the cheese incorporates, the sauce will become thicker and glossier.

Step 4: Season and Adjust

Add salt, black pepper, and the herbs, then taste the sauce. If it feels too thick, stir in a splash of pasta water until it reaches the consistency you like. If it seems a little thin, keep it over low heat for another minute or two until it tightens naturally.

Step 5: Toss and Serve

Add hot cooked pasta directly to the skillet and toss until every strand is coated. Serve immediately with extra Parmesan and a little parsley on top. Alfredo sauce is at its best right away, when it is warm, creamy, and perfectly smooth.

Best Ways to Serve Rich and Creamy Homemade Alfredo Sauce

This recipe comfortably serves about 4 people as a pasta sauce, depending on portion size and what you pair with it. For a fuller meal, serve it with fettuccine, linguine, or penne and top with grilled chicken, sautéed shrimp, or roasted broccoli. It is also delicious spooned over stuffed pasta, baked potatoes, or even used as a creamy layer in casseroles.

For a balanced dinner, pair this sauce with a crisp green salad, garlic bread, or roasted vegetables. The richness of Alfredo loves contrast, so something bright, fresh, or lightly crunchy on the side makes the whole meal feel even better.

How to Store Rich and Creamy Homemade Alfredo Sauce

Homemade Alfredo sauce stores best in an airtight container in the refrigerator for up to 3 days. As it chills, the sauce will thicken considerably, which is completely normal because of the butter, cream, and cheese.

To reheat, place it in a saucepan over very low heat and stir often. Add a splash of milk, cream, or water to loosen it gradually as it warms. Avoid microwaving it on high or bringing it to a hard boil on the stove, since high heat can cause the sauce to separate or become grainy.

Freezing is not ideal for Alfredo sauce because dairy-based sauces can change texture after thawing. It is still possible in a pinch, but for the smoothest, creamiest result, fresh or refrigerated leftovers are the better choice.

Frequently Asked Questions

Can I make Alfredo sauce without heavy cream?

Yes, but the texture will change. Heavy cream gives the sauce its classic thick, rich finish. Half-and-half or whole milk can work, though the sauce will be lighter and less silky. If you use a thinner dairy option, you may need to simmer it a bit longer or use a little more cheese to help it come together.

Why did my Alfredo sauce turn grainy?

This usually happens when the heat is too high or the cheese is added too quickly. Parmesan melts best over low heat and when it is stirred in gradually. Freshly grated cheese also helps, since pre-shredded cheese often contains anti-caking agents that can affect the texture.

What pasta is best with Alfredo sauce?

Fettuccine is the classic choice because its broad noodles hold onto the creamy sauce so well. That said, linguine, tagliatelle, penne, and even tortellini all work beautifully. The best pasta is often the one that gives you plenty of surface area for the sauce to cling to.

Can I add protein or vegetables to this sauce?

Absolutely. Grilled chicken, shrimp, salmon, mushrooms, broccoli, peas, and spinach all pair wonderfully with Alfredo sauce. The key is to cook those ingredients separately and add them at the end so the sauce stays smooth and doesn’t get watered down.

How do I keep Alfredo sauce creamy after mixing with pasta?

Reserve a little pasta water before draining the noodles. That starchy water helps loosen the sauce and keeps it glossy once tossed with pasta. Serving it right away also makes a big difference, since Alfredo sauce naturally thickens as it sits.

Want More Pasta and Sauce Ideas?

If this Rich and Creamy Homemade Alfredo Sauce is going straight into your comfort food rotation, you may also want to explore a few more creamy and pasta-friendly favorites:

You can also find more daily recipe inspiration on Life With Livia.

Save This Pin For Later

📌 Save this recipe to your Pinterest dinner board so you can come back to it any time.

And let me know in the comments how yours turned out. Did you keep it classic with fettuccine, or add chicken, shrimp, or vegetables to make it your own?

I love hearing how others bring these recipes to life in their kitchens. Questions are always welcome too, and sharing your little tweaks can help someone else make their next pasta night even better.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Rich and Creamy Homemade Alfredo Sauce


  • Author: Livia Scott
  • Total Time: 15 minutes
  • Yield: 4 servings
  • Diet: Vegetarian

Description

Rich and Creamy Homemade Alfredo Sauce is the kind of easy recipe that instantly upgrades any pasta night into a comforting restaurant-style meal. This quick dinner idea is smooth, buttery, and packed with rich Parmesan flavor, making it perfect for easy dinner plans, cozy food ideas, and simple homemade sauce recipes you will want to make again and again.


Ingredients

1 cup butter

2 cups heavy cream

3 cloves garlic, minced

2 cups freshly grated Parmesan cheese

1/2 teaspoon salt

1/2 teaspoon black pepper

1 teaspoon Italian seasoning

1/4 cup pasta water


Instructions

1. Melt the butter in a skillet over medium-low heat. Add the minced garlic and cook just until fragrant.

2. Pour in the heavy cream and stir well. Let it warm gently for a few minutes without boiling.

3. Lower the heat and add the Parmesan cheese a little at a time, stirring constantly until fully melted and smooth.

4. Season with salt, black pepper, and Italian seasoning. Stir until combined.

5. Add pasta water as needed to loosen the sauce to your desired consistency.

6. Toss with hot cooked pasta and serve immediately with extra Parmesan if desired.

Notes

Use freshly grated Parmesan instead of pre-shredded cheese so the sauce melts smoothly and does not turn grainy.

  • Prep Time: 5 minutes
  • Cook Time: 10 minutes
  • Category: Sauce
  • Method: Stovetop
  • Cuisine: Italian-American

Nutrition

  • Serving Size: 1 serving
  • Calories: 548
  • Sugar: 2 g
  • Sodium: 642 mg
  • Fat: 53 g
  • Saturated Fat: 33 g
  • Unsaturated Fat: 16 g
  • Trans Fat: 1 g
  • Carbohydrates: 6 g
  • Fiber: 0 g
  • Protein: 13 g
  • Cholesterol: 161 mg

Keywords: homemade alfredo sauce, creamy alfredo sauce, easy pasta sauce, quick dinner idea, rich parmesan sauce, easy dinner, food ideas

WANT TO SAVE THIS RECIPE?

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ating

Easy Cranberry Pecan Baked Brie

Old-Fashioned Martha Washington Candy